About This Cessna 400SL

This 2007 Cessna 400SL (N5969H) is a 4-seat single engine piston with 1,321 hours on the airframe. There are currently 2 400SL aircraft listed for sale .

The 400SL cruises at 220 kts (407 km/h) with a range of 1,100 nm (2,037 km) — suitable for regional and medium-distance travel. Service ceiling of 25,000 ft allows operation above most weather.

Operating costs: Fuel burn is 17.5 GPH (66 L/h), which at current 100LL avgas prices (~$6.20/gal) means approximately $108/hr in fuel alone. Total variable cost including maintenance reserves is approximately $200/hr. Annual fixed costs (hangar, insurance, crew, annual inspection) average $26,000. With 1,321 hours on the airframe, this aircraft has 679 hours remaining to engine TBO .

NTSB records show 0 incidents for this airframe — a clean safety record.
